In 2003, she joined the cast of the NBC soap opera Passions as the third actress to portray the role of Jessica Bennett. Stewart, a natural blonde, dyed her hair black for her role on Passions.
As a blonde, she briefly played Maxie Jones on the ABC soap opera General Hospital in 2002. She was meant to be playing the role of Roxanne "Rocky" Briggs in a WB pilot called "Home of the Brave". The pilot didn't make it through and the show about a military man and his returning to his four children was never aired.
She was born to John and Donna Stewart. She was a cheerleader at high school and acted once a month. She graduated in 2001 from Southridge High School in Kennewick, Washington.
